## Ticket: Vault Locked — Addresswise Widget Keys

The credentials vault holding the Addresswise autocomplete signing keys locked itself after the failover test. New team members: do not retry the admin login, as repeated attempts extend the lockout. Use the recovery flow from the vault console instead, and when prompted, supply the passphrase recorded just below.

strongbox words: sorir-belvan-rusix-ulays-ralmir-praix-eliir-tamax-praael-druael-julir-tamius-jorir

2024-xx — Key rotation (Pipsqueak CI). Heads up, new folks: we rotated signing keys after discovering the build agents in the Thornvale rack had drifted almost four minutes apart, which made timestamp validation flaky. NTP is fixed and agents now re-sync hourly. Old keys are revoked as of this entry. The current signing key is below.

rollout seal: bky4_x7Gc

Step 6: Enable idempotency keys on the Tollgate retry path. Every payment retry must reuse the key minted on the first attempt; minting a fresh key per retry defeats deduplication and has historically caused double charges during gateway flaps. Keys are stored in the ledger sidecar with a bounded TTL, so retries beyond that window fail closed by design. Verify the sidecar boots with these values:

service settings:
PRAIX_LOG_LEVEL=error
PRAIX_METRICS_HOST=metrics.praix.qorvelcorp.corp
PRAIX_POOL_SIZE=16

Subject: Rotation — Timegrid solver key

Rotating the credential the Timegrid solver uses to reach the internal Roomledger constraint service. Old key dies Friday 18:00. Release impact: the 4.2 build bakes the key into the solver config, so cut the release after the rotation lands or the scheduler runs will fail validation and schools on the pilot list will see stale timetables. Canary first, then full rollout — same order as last quarter. No other services affected. New key for Roomledger is below.

gateway credential: kto3_qfe